Create a folder in Storage/My Documents ans call it TomTom then drop a picture file in there. TT5 requires this folder as it plonks a file in there but It wont create it on its own unless of course your running an original version :)

ok here is the easy way I found to get it to see the gps bluethooth when you pair the device rename it BT-GPS not TomTom Wireless GPS and it works fine, it deleted it on mine when I named it TomTom Wireless GPS but worked fine when named BT-GPS.
